Transaction 28a5e9893a1737a9bd6e9e25b94d1baf65090308c980b5be13649b0f7aa454a9
1 Input
1 Output
-
28a5e9893a1737a9bd6e9e25b94d1baf65090308c980b5be13649b0f7aa454a9:0
- value
- 492452
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 51ec09e537c35073964f8fd602a57914d2c61fa3 OP_EQUAL
- address
- 39ABRLPscPiwy6E6P6eJLYDYfT8KtFeEa6